The 110th Commemoration Ceremony of the Most Venerable Hikkaduwe Sri Sumangala Nayake Thero will be held on 29th April 2021 at the University premises.  The ceremony will commence at 8.30 a.m. with offering Amisa Pooja at the Buddha Shrine of the University and will be followed by the commemorative oration by Agga Maha Panditha Dr. Walpola Piyananda Thero, Chief Buddhist Prelate of United States of America (USA) and the Chief Incumbent of the Buddhist Temple, Los Angeles, USA. This ceremony will take place with a minimum number of staff while adhering to strict health guidelines.

The outstanding service rendered by the Most Venerable Hikkaduwe Sri Sumangala  Maha Nayake Thero as far back as 1870s have paved way to create many educated generations bearing virtues and dedication. Had it not been for the Thero’s vision and mission, there would not be a University of Sri Jayewardenepura today.
